Show Notes

Who we are is shaped by how we see the world, whether that is our faith, our community, our family. They all create our culture - and culture is not limited to race, geographic location, or socioeconomic status. Understanding someone's culture can help you support them in making lasting health behavior changes. You do not need to be an expert in world religions to allow faith to be a part of your conversation around health and nutrition. Zach Cordell is a dietitian, professor, speaker, host of The Latter-day Saint Nutritionist podcast, and author of The Creation Code. We discuss food, nutrition, faith, science, culture, family and behavior change. Get the full shownotes at www.SoundBitesRD.com/118
